A leading UK insurer is looking for a Consultant – Specialist Disciplines Actuarial. This role involves owning the portfolio management framework, advising senior stakeholders, and shaping performance management strategies.

Candidates should have experience in portfolio management or advanced analytics, preferably within insurance, and possess strong skills in data analysis tools like R, SQL, and Power BI.

This is a full-time position located in London, England with genuine strategic influence.
